Output 2a2620dc622bfac912ac670dacb72a6eb3dda240263ad56f3262a2c60d0b42a2:0

value
596408263
script pubkey
OP_0 OP_PUSHBYTES_20 4ad6a19c3bc31b8975a876e4da71acbd1730604d
address
ltc1qftt2r8pmcvdcjadgwmjd5udvh5tnqczdrustde
transaction
2a2620dc622bfac912ac670dacb72a6eb3dda240263ad56f3262a2c60d0b42a2
spent
true